JUSTICE SHIVAJI PANDEY ORAL ORDER 29-09-2016 Since both the cases have arisen out of the same dispute, they have been heard together and are being disposed of by this common order.

Both the parties are agreeable that they do not want to live with each other. It was love marriage, organized at

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.12534 of 2016 (4) dt.29-09-2016 Mandir as per Hindu Rites accordingly they have entered into matrimonial relationship. Parents of both the parties were present to witness the marriage but they cannot live together for a long period finally separated themselves and they have also filed a case and counter case making allegation and counter allegation to each other. Girl (wife) has filed a criminal which has been registered as Complaint Case No. 1532 of 2013 making an allegation of torture and demand of dowry whereas husband has also lodged a case which has been registered as Runisaidpur P.S. Case No. 118 of 2014 against his wife making an allegation that she (Pratibha Kumari) committed theft and has taken away the ornaments and other articles from his house.

Both sides say that they want to lead a peaceful life by dissolving matrimonial life that can be done by filing an application under Section 13(b) of the Hindu Marriage Act, 1955. Pratibha Kumari has already filed divorce case vide Matrimonial Case No.969 of 2013. If such an application is pending both parties are at liberty to file an application under section 13(b) of the Hindu Marriage Act, 1955 and if such an application is filed the court below is directed to examine the matter and try to dissolve the dispute as early as possible in terms of the aforesaid provision.

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.12534 of 2016 (4) dt.29-09-2016 In view of the fact that both parties are not ready to live each other and they want to lead a peaceful life, both parties have agreed that there is no need to continuation of criminal proceeding as it is nothing but continuation of incarceration against both sides.

In such view of the matter, order dated 1.7.2015 passed by the Sub Divisional Judicial Magistrate, Patna City in Complaint Case No.1532 of 2013 and the order dated 20.12.205/21.12.2015 passed by the Chief Judicial Magistrate, Sitamarhi in connection with Runisaidur P.S. Case No.118 of 2014, G.R. No.1166 of 2014, Tr. No. 1055 of 2016 are hereby quashed.

Accordingly both the applications are allowed. (Shivaji Pandey, J) Vinay/- U T
